I found the following list of SSRI drugs From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ia.

 

List of SSRIs Selective Serotonin Reuptake Inhibitors

Drugs in this class include:
(Trade names in parentheses)

citalopram (Celexa, Cipramil, Emocal, Sepram, Seropram)

escitalopram oxalate (Lexapro, Cipralex, Esertia)

fluoxetine (Prozac, Fontex, Seromex, Seronil, Sarafem, Fluctin (EUR), Fluox (NZ))

fluvoxamine maleate (Luvox, Faverin)

paroxetine (Paxil, Seroxat, Aropax, Deroxat, Rexetin, Xetanor, Paroxat)

sertraline (Zoloft, Lustral, Serlain)

dapoxetine (no known trade name)

All the above drugs are forbidden to be prescribed in people under the age of 18 in United Kingdom, except Prozac.
